(adults and teens 16 yrs+)
Experience the joy of painting outdoors at Reeves-Reed Arboretum in this plein air painting workshop led by artist Eric Alexander Santoli. Surrounded by the rich colors and textures of late summer transitioning into early fall, participants will work directly from the landscape, capturing the beauty, atmosphere, and changing gardens of the Arboretum.
The workshop will focus on rapid, alla prima (one-sitting) painting techniques, helping artists interpret the landscape efficiently while responding to shifting light and weather conditions. Instruction will emphasize developing strong compositions, effective use of color theory, and confident decision-making when working outdoors.
This special program follows Reeves-Reed Arboretum’s featured appearance in an episode of Eric’s public television series, Eric En Plein Air, which aired earlier this summer.
Open to all experience levels. All watercolor supplies are included; however, participants are welcome to bring their own materials and mediums if they prefer. Participants are encouraged to bring a camping chair with a cup holder and an easel, if they have one.
